Flexing from the Pacific Ocean to the Mayacamas Mountains, Sonoma County is among California’s most geographically diverse wine locations. Its own mix of sea influence, differed altitudes, complex dirts, and also countless microclimates makes suitable shapes for increasing a remarkable series of grapes. Today, the area possesses 19 United States Viticultural Places (AVAs) and also much more than 60 grape varieties, making it among the absolute most unique premium wine-growing areas in the USA. What Creates Sonoma County White Wine So Exclusive?
The technique responsible for Sonoma County red wine begins with terroir– the blend of climate, ground, geographics, as well as ecological ailments that determines just how grapes develop and inevitably exactly how white wine flavors.
Sonoma Region take advantage of its own closeness to the Pacific Ocean. Cool ocean breezes and coastal smog help mild temperatures, specifically in western side as well as southern places. Warm and comfortable, bright times motivate grapes to advance, while cool evenings assist keep acidity as well as equilibrium. In some regions, daily temperature variations can easily exceed 40 degrees Fahrenheit.
The county likewise consists of an impressive range of soils. Excitable, alluvial, sedimentary, clay-based, and gravelly dirts develop throughout the region, producing unique increasing problems coming from one lowland or even hillside to one more. These distinctions assist reveal why Sonoma can create both delicate cool-climate wines and also abundant, organized reddishes.
Discovering Sonoma Area’s Wine Regions
One of the best methods to understand Sonoma County red wine is to discover its personal AVAs.
Russian River Lowland is specifically widely known for Pinot Noir as well as Chardonnay. Its own cold environment, affected by haze flowing inland from the Pacific, makes it possible for grapes to develop flavor while keeping stimulating acidity. The region is actually also recognized for Goldridge dirt, a well-drained sandy soil linked with high quality Pinot Noir and also Chardonnay.
For fanatics of vibrant wines, Alexander Valley is actually a must-know location. Warmer problems make it specifically properly matched to Cabernet Sauvignon. The lowland experiences cozy time frames that urge ripening while cool evenings assist maintain quality as well as framework.
Dry Spring Lowland has actually gained an image for meaningful Zinfandel, while Sonoma Valley delivers an interesting mixture of history, scenery, and also assorted red wine styles. Sonoma Lowland is actually additionally thought about the place of origin of The golden state red or white wine as well as consists of numerous distinct AVAs within its own wider landscape.
At the western edge of the area, the West Sonoma Coastline gives a completely different knowledge. Its high, sturdy vineyards are firmly affected due to the Pacific Sea, with awesome as well as tough increasing health conditions particularly suited to varieties like Pinot Noir, Chardonnay, and Syrah.
The Grapes to Seek
Although Sonoma Area produces greater than 60 grape assortments, numerous dominate the region’s wine identification. These feature Chardonnay, Pinot Noir, Cabernet Sauvignon, Zinfandel, Merlot, and Sauvignon Blanc, which together make up almost 94 per-cent of the region’s red or white wine grapes depending on to Sonoma County’s place simple fact slab.
Pinot Noir is actually an exceptional selection for red or white wine enthusiasts that appreciate fragrant, classy reds along with good level of acidity. Sonoma’s cooler locations can make Pinot Noir with layers of fruit product, planet, flavor, as well as impressive diplomacy.
Chardonnay enthusiasts will definitely find substantial variety, varying coming from stimulating as well as mineral-driven examples to richer glass of wines with creamy textures as well as maple influences.
Cabernet Sauvignon is particularly convincing in warmer inland locations including Alexander Lowland, where grapes can attain concentration while sustaining the freshness provided by refreshing evenings.
Zinfandel is actually one more Sonoma standard. Dry Creek Lowland articulations may incorporate mature fruit and also flavor with design, giving a distinctly Californian analysis of this historical grape.
Durability and Sonoma Red Wine
An additional factor Sonoma County red or white wine attracts attention is actually the area’s devotion to lasting farming. Depending On to Sonoma County Tourist, 99 per-cent of the area’s roughly 60,000 vineyard acres are actually accredited lasting, while the region possesses greater than 425 wineries. Sustainable methods can easily incorporate soil health, water preservation, electricity productivity, habitation preservation, and community partnerships.
